What was the purpose of Tronick's still face experiment?
To show the importance of
caregiver
interaction
View source
What was the infant's reaction when the mother stopped interacting in the still face experiment?
The infant became
uncomfortable
and sought
interaction
View source
What does the still face experiment suggest about caregiver interactions?
They are crucial for forming
attachments
